<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@charset "utf-8";
@import url(dll.css);
@import url(module.css);
@import url(global.css);
@import url(/onlinecss/onlineeditor.css);
@import url(ddsmoothmenu.css);
@import url(animate.css);
@import url(banner.css);
/* 首页部分开始 */
.mfbox{width:1200px;min-width:1200px;margin:0 auto;position:relative;}
.header{width:100%; height:90px;}

.logo{float:left;/*margin-top: 20px;*/}
.language{ float:right; z-index:9999; position:relative; line-height:30px; display:none;}
.language li{ float:left; padding-left:5px;}

.i_nav{float:right; height:90px; z-index:9999; position:absolute; right:0px;}
/*.i_nav li{float:left; display:inline-block;}
.i_nav li &gt; a{ display:block; font-size:16px; height:90px; padding:0 25px; line-height:90px; color:#666; text-align:center;}
.i_nav li &gt; a:hover{ color:#FFF; background:#0473ae;}
.i_nav li &gt; a.on{ color:#FFF; background:#0473ae;}*/

.i_banner_box{position:relative; width:100%; overflow:hidden;    height: 559px;}
.i_banner{ float:left; display:inline;}
/*.i_banner li{width:100%; height:590px;}
.i_banner li a{display:block; width:100%; height:590px;}
.i_banner_p{position:absolute; width:100%; left:0; bottom:20px; text-align:center;}
.i_banner_p a{display:inline-block; margin:0 15px; width:100px; height:6px; overflow:hidden; background:#FFF;}
.i_banner_p a:hover{ background:#0473ae;}
.i_banner_p a.on{ background:#0473ae;}*/

.i_container{overflow:hidden;}
.i_container *{transition:all 0.4s; -webkit-transition:all 0.4s; -moz-transition:all 0.4s;}

.i_pro01{ padding:70px 0;}
.i_pro01_l{ position:relative; margin:30px auto 0; width:1220px; text-align:center;}
.i_pro01_l li{float:left; display:inline-block; margin:0 10px; width:285px;}
.i_pro01_l li i{ display:block; width:285px; height:211px; overflow:hidden;}
.i_pro01_l li i img{ width:285px; height:211px;}
.i_pro01_l li span{ display:block; width:285px; height:64px; line-height:64px; color:#666; font-size:18px; border-width:0 1px 1px; border-color:#c2c2c2; border-style:solid;}
.i_pro01_l li:hover{ display:block; -webkit-box-shadow:0 1px 4px rgba(3, 75, 113, .4); -moz-box-shadow:0 1px 4px rgba(3, 75, 113, .4); box-shadow:0 1px 4px rgba(3, 75, 113, .4)}
.i_pro01_l li a:hover i img{transform:scale(1.2); -webkit-transform:scale(1.2); -moz-transform:scale(1.2); -o-transform:scale(1.2); }
.i_pro01_l li a:hover span{ background:#0473ae; color:#FFF; border-color:#0473ae;}
.i_pro01_lc{width:1220px; overflow:hidden;}


.i_pro02{ padding:40px 0; background:url(../Images/icon02.jpg) no-repeat center bottom #f9f9f9;}
.i_pro02_l{ margin:40px auto 0; width:1220px; text-align:center;}
.i_pro02_l li{float:left; display:inline-block; margin:0 10px 20px; width:285px;}
.i_pro02_l li i{ display:block; width:285px; height:227px; overflow:hidden;}
.i_pro02_l li i img{ width:285px; height:227px;}
.i_pro02_l li span{ display:block; width:283px; height:64px; line-height:64px; color:#666; font-size:18px; background:#FFF; border-width:0 1px 1px; border-color:#c2c2c2; border-style:solid;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;}
/*.i_pro02_l li:hover{ display:block; -webkit-box-shadow:0 1px 4px rgba(3, 75, 113, .4); -moz-box-shadow:0 1px 4px rgba(3, 75, 113, .4); box-shadow:0 1px 4px rgba(3, 75, 113, .4)}
*/.i_pro02_l li a:hover i img{transform:scale(1.2); -webkit-transform:scale(1.2); -moz-transform:scale(1.2); -o-transform:scale(1.2); }
.i_pro02_l li a:hover span{ background:#0473ae; color:#FFF; border-color:#0473ae;}

.i_about{ padding:70px 0;}
.i_about_c{ margin:40px auto 0; width:1200px; font-size:14px; line-height:24px;}

.footer{/* position:relative; */width:100%;padding:50px 0 10px 0;background:url(../Images/icon03.jpg) no-repeat center bottom #fafafa;color:#FFF;min-width:1200px;z-index:9990;}

.fcontact{float:left; width:580px; padding:0 20px 0 0; text-align:center; color:#666; text-align:left;position: static;}
.fcontact h4{ display:block; font-size:24px; letter-spacing:5px; line-height:40px;}
.fcontact span{ display:block; font-size:14px; line-height:30px; margin-top:10px;}
.fcontact a{display:inline-block; width:37px; height:31px; margin-right:20px; margin-top:15px;}
.fcontact a.fc_qq{ background:url(../Images/icon04.png) no-repeat center center;}
.fcontact a.fc_wx{ background:url(../Images/icon05.png) no-repeat center center;}
.fcontact a.fc_wb{ background:url(../Images/icon06.png) no-repeat center center;}

.footergbook{float:right; width:600px;}
.footergbook h4{ display:block; font-size:24px; letter-spacing:5px; line-height:40px; color:#666;}
.footergbook ul{ margin-top:10px;}
.footergbook li{float:left;}
.footergbook li input{ height:44px; line-height:44px; border:1px solid #aaaaaa; background:transparent; font-family:microsoft yahei; color:#666; font-size:14px; text-indent:10px;}

.footergbook li:nth-child(1){width:250px;}
.footergbook li:nth-child(1) input{width:250px;}

.footergbook li:nth-child(2){width:335px; margin-left:11px;}
.footergbook li:nth-child(2) input{width:335px;}

.footergbook li:nth-child(3){width:600px; margin-top:11px;}
.footergbook li:nth-child(3) textarea{width:578px; height:80px; padding:5px 10px; line-height:25px; border:1px solid #aaaaaa; background:transparent; font-family:microsoft yahei; color:#666;}

.footergbook span{display:block; margin-top:11px;}
.footergbook span input{width:90px; height:38px; cursor:pointer; line-height:38px; color:#FFF; border:1px solid #aaa; background:#0473ae; font-family:microsoft yahei; font-size:14px;}
.footergbook span input:hover{ color:#0473ae; background:#FFF;}

.footer_nav{line-height:30px; margin-top:20px; text-align:center; color:#323334; }

.footer_nav a{ padding:0 10px; color:#323334; font-size:14px; line-height:30px;}

.copyright{ line-height:30px; color:#323334; text-align:center; font-size:14px;}
.jsq{ line-height:30px; color:#323334; text-align:center; font-size:14px;}

.footer a:hover{ color:#008acb;}

/* 首页部分结束 */

/* 内页部分开始 */
.p_banner_box{position:relative; width:100%; height:300px; overflow:hidden; z-index:1000;}
.p_banner{ float:left; display:inline;}
/*.p_banner li{width:100%; height:300px;}
.p_banner li a{display:block; width:100%; height:300px;}*/
.p_banner_box .rol{top:110px;}
.p_banner_box .ror{top:110px;}

.p_container{ position:relative; padding:10px; width:1140px; min-height:500px; margin:0px auto 0; z-index:9000; background:#FFF; -webkit-box-shadow:0 0 30px rgba(0, 0, 0, .3); -moz-box-shadow:0 0 30px rgba(0, 0, 0, .3); box-shadow:0 0 30px rgba(0, 0, 0, .3);  }

.p_left{float:left; width:230px; overflow:hidden;}
.p_right{float:right; width:880px; overflow:hidden;}

.sidebar{}
/*.sidebar .title03{ padding-top:30px;}
.sidebar_l li{ height:50px; line-height:50px; border:1px solid #eeeeee; border-top:0; background:#eef9ff;}
.sidebar_l li a{ display:block; font-size:18px; color:#333333; text-indent:45px;}
.sidebar_l li a:hover{ color:#0473ae; background:url(../Images/icon07.jpg) no-repeat left center;}
.sidebar_l li a.on{ color:#0473ae; background:url(../Images/icon07.jpg) no-repeat left center;}*/

.pl_contact{ margin-top:20px;}
.pl_contact_c{ background:#f6f6f6; padding:15px; color:#666; line-height:30px; font-size:14px; border:1px solid #eeeeee; border-top:0;}

.path{ height:38px; line-height:38px; text-indent:25px; font-size:14px; border-bottom:1px solid #e8e8e8; background:url(../Images/icon08.png) no-repeat left center;}
.path a{ padding:0 10px;}

.p_about{padding:30px 10px; line-height:28px; font-size:14px;}


/* 内页部分结束 */


/*添加样式，控制按钮显示方式*/
.navbar-toggle {
    background: rgba(0, 0, 0, 0) url("http://xysjx010.no1.35nic.com/templates/Images/Images/icon01.png") no-repeat scroll center center / 70% auto;
    border: 2px solid #1b2086;
    border-radius: 0;
    float: right;
    height: 65px;
    width: 65px;
}
.navbar-toggle {
    position: absolute;
    background: rgba(0, 0, 0, 0) url("http://xysjx010.no1.35nic.com/templates/Images/navbtn.png") no-repeat scroll center center / 70% auto;
    border: 2px solid #2b84c8;
    border-radius: 0;
    right: 0;
   height: 55px;
width: 55px;
margin: 15px;}
/*控制默认值为隐藏*/
.navbar-toggle {
    display: none;
}
/*响应式部分开始*/
@media screen and (max-width: 1024px) {/*当屏幕尺寸小于1024px时，应用下面的CSS样式*/
.mfbox { width: 100%; min-width: inherit; margin: 0 auto;text-align: center;}
.i_pro02_l li {float: left; display: inline-block; margin: 0 6px 20px;width: 32%;}
.footer {width: 100%;min-width: auto;}
.fcontact {margin: 0 auto;/*width: 94%;float:none;*/width: 46%;float: left;padding:0px;}
.footergbook { float: left; /*width: 100%;*/width: 46%;}
#gbookTopic { width: 82% !important;height: 46px !important;margin-bottom: 10px;}
#userMail { width: 82% !important;height: 46px !important;margin-left: auto !important;}
#gbookMain { width: 82% !important;height: 100px !important;}
.i_pro02_l li i {text-align: center;margin: 0 auto;}
.i_pro02_l li span { margin: 0 auto;}
.i_pro02_l li i img {width: 100%;height:auto;}
.i_about_c { width: 96%;}
.i_pro01_l{width:100%;margin: 0 auto;}
.i_pro01_lc{width:900px;}
.i_pro01_lc{width:260px; margin:0 35px;}
.i_pro01_lc li img{width:260px; height:260px;}
.i_pro01_lc li span{ padding:15px 0;}
.projecttitle{ text-indent:10px;}
.projectcon li { width:46%; margin:0 2% 30px 2%;}
.rol02, .ror02{top:90px; z-index:999;}
.rol02{left:22px;}
.ror02{right:40px;}
#Agentslist1 {width: 80% !important;margin-left: 70px;}
.i_pro01_l li { width: 285px !important;}
.p_container {width: 100%;padding-top: 0px;    min-height: auto;}
.p_left { float: none;width: 100%;margin: 0 auto;padding: 10px;}
.pl_contact { display: none;}
.sortnavul li { width: 50%;float: left;overflow: hidden;}
.p_right { float: none;width:100%;overflow: hidden;margin: 0 auto;    padding: 10px;}
.p_p_list {width: 100%;margin: 0 auto;text-align: center;}
.p_p_list li {/*width: 32%;margin: 0 auto;text-align: center;margin-left: 0px;float: none;margin-bottom: 10px;*/float: left;
display: inline-block;
margin: 0 5px 20px;
width: 32%;}
.p_p_list li a {width: 100%;display: block;text-align: center;margin: 0 auto;}
.p_p_list li i { text-align: center;margin: 0 auto;}
.navPage{width:100%;}
.n_n_list li a { width: 70%;}
.n_n_list li {width: 100%;}
.fcontact h4 {font-size: 19px;}
.sortnavul li a {text-indent: 0px;text-align: center;}
.p_p_list li i img { width: 100%;height: auto;}
.nava {padding: 0px 20px;}
.nava:hover,.navactive:hover{padding: 0px 20px;}
.selected,.navactive{padding: 0px 20px;}
.sortnavt { padding: 0px 20px 5px 20px; height: 36px;}
.sortnavul li { height: 26px;line-height: 26px;}
.sortnavul li a {font-size: 12px;}
}/*当屏幕尺寸小于1024px时，结束应用下面的CSS样式*/

@media screen and (max-width: 980px) {/*当屏幕尺寸小于980px时，应用下面的CSS样式*/
.i_nav{display:none;position:relative;}
.navbar-toggle{display:block;}
.i_nav { width: 100%; height: auto; right: 0; z-index: 9999;}
.ddsmoothmenu ul {  width: 100%;}
.ddsmoothmenu ul li {  width: 100%; height: auto;border-bottom: 1px #f6f6f6 solid;background: #006caa;}
.nava:hover,.navactive:hover { background: #fff;}
.ddsmoothmenu ul li  a{color:#fff;}
.ddsmoothmenu ul li  a:hover{color:#006caa;}
.ddsmoothmenu ul li a.navactive {width: 100%;background: #006caa;}
.nava { width: 100%; height: 40px; line-height: 40px; border: none;}
.navactive, .navactive:hover { width: 100%;line-height: 40px; height: 40px;background: #006caa;padding:0px;}
.navactive, .navactive:hover, .nava, .nava:hover { width: 100%;font-size: 13px;padding:0px;line-height:40px;}
.ddsmoothmenu ul li a {width: 100%;}
.i_nav ul li ul { position: relative; width: 100% !important;}
.i_nav ul li ul li { width: 100%; border: 0;}
.i_nav ul li ul li a { width: 100%;}
.i_pro02_l{width: 100%;}
}/*当屏幕尺寸小于980px时，结束应用下面的CSS样式*/

@media screen and (max-width: 800px) { /*当屏幕尺寸小于760px时，应用下面的CSS样式*/
  .i_pro02_l li {width: 30%; margin: 0 12px 20px;}
  .i_pro02_l li i {width: 100%;height: auto;}
  .i_pro02_l li i img {  width: 100%; height: 200px;}
  .i_pro02_l li span {width: 100%;}
  .p_p_list li{width: 30%; }
   .p_p_list li i {width: 100%;height: 160px;}
   .p_p_list li i img {  width: 100%; height: 160px;}
  .p_p_list li span {width: 100%;height: 32px;line-height: 32px;}
  .iconfont.icon-next-copy {font-size: 30px !important;}
  .footer{padding:0px;}
  .sortnavul li {width: 20%;}
 .logo { padding-left: 10px;
}
 }/*当屏幕尺寸小于800px时，结束应用下面的CSS样式*/ 
@media screen and (max-width: 760px) { /*当屏幕尺寸小于760px时，应用下面的CSS样式*/
/*.i_pro01_l{width:680px;}
.i_pro01_lc{width:660px !important;}*/
.i_pro01_lc li{width:290px; margin: 0 65px;}
.i_pro01_lc li img{width:290px; height:290px;}
.rol02, .ror02{top:120px;}
.rol02{left:0px;}
.ror02{right:200px;}
.i_pro02_l li { width: 42%;margin: 0 auto;text-align: center;margin-left: 0px;float: none;margin-bottom: 10px;}
.i_pro02_l li a{width:100%;display:block;text-align: center;margin: 0 auto;}
.rol02 {left: 5px;}
.ror02 {right: 182px;}
.sortnavul li {width: 33.3%;}
.p_v_list li a:hover i img{transform:none; -webkit-transform:none; -moz-transform:none; -o-transform:none; }
}/*当屏幕尺寸小于760px时，结束应用下面的CSS样式*/


@media screen and (max-width: 480px){/*当屏幕尺寸小于480px时，应用下面的CSS样式*/

#Agentslist1{width:100% !important;margin-left: 36px ;}
.i_pro01_lc li{width:320px; margin:0 50px 0 30px;}
.i_pro01_lc li img{width:320px; height:320px;}
.rol02, .ror02{top:160px;}
.rol02{left:-30px;}
.ror02{right:-30px;}
.i_pro02_l li {width: 90%;margin: 0 auto;text-align: center;margin-left: 0px;float: none;margin-bottom: 10px;}
.i_pro02_l li span {margin: 0 auto;}
.i_pro02_l li i { text-align: center;margin: 0 auto;}
 .i_pro02_l li a{width:100%;display:block;text-align: center;margin: 0 auto;}
  .p_p_list li {width: 46%;}
  .i_pro01 {width: 100%;padding: 15px;margin: 0 auto;}
  .fcontact {margin: 0 auto;width: 94%;float:none;padding:0px;}
.footergbook { float: left; width: 100%;}
}/*当屏幕尺寸小于480px时，结束应用下面的CSS样式*/

@media screen and (max-width: 414px) { /*当屏幕尺寸小于414px时，应用下面的CSS样式*/

.p_p_list li { width: 100%;margin-left: 0px;}
#Agentslist1 { margin-left: 0px;}
.rol02 { left: -10px;}
.rol02, .ror02 { top: 122px;}
.ror02 { right: -12px;}
}/*当屏幕尺寸小于414px时，结束应用下面的CSS样式*/

@media screen and (max-width: 360px) {/*当屏幕尺寸小于360px时，应用下面的CSS样式*/
.i_pro_l { width: 260px;}
.rol02 { left: -12px;}
.rol02, .ror02 { top: 80px;}
.ror02 { right: -9px;}
.i_pro01_lc { width: 260px !important;}
.i_pro01_lc  li {margin: 0 50px 0 30px;}
.i_pro01_lc span { padding: 15px 0;}
.i_pro01_l li span {display: block;height: 64px; line-height: 64px;color: #666;font-size: 18px;
    						  border-width: 0 1px 1px;border-color: #c2c2c2;border-style: solid;}
.i_pro01_l li i { display: block; overflow: hidden;}
.i_pro01_l li a:hover span{ background:#0473ae; color:#FFF; border-color:#0473ae; }
.i_pro02_l li { width: 90%;margin: 0 auto;text-align: center;margin-left: 0px;float: none;margin-bottom: 10px;}
.p_p_list li {width: 90%;margin: 0 auto;text-align: center;margin-left: 0px;float: none;margin-bottom: 10px;}
.iconfont.icon-next-copy {font-size: 26px !important;}
#Agentslist1 {width:100% !important;margin-left: -12px;}
.rol02 a { background-size: 15px;}
.ror02 a { background-size: 15px;}
.rol02 a:hover{background-size: 15px;}
.ror02 a:hover{background-size: 15px;}
}/*当屏幕尺寸小于360px时，结束应用下面的CSS样式*/
textarea#gbookMain {
    margin-top: 10px;
}
@media screen and (max-width: 320px) {/*当屏幕尺寸小于320px时，应用下面的CSS样式*/
.i_pro01 { width: 100%; padding: 0px; margin: 0 auto;}
.rol02 {left: -6px;}
.ror02 { right: -6px;}
}</pre></body></html>